• The steam mop is equipped with a thermostat and a thermal cut out. If for any reason the steam mop overheats it will switch off. If this happens turn off and unplug the steam mop, allow to cool for a least 2 to 4 hours and re-start.

When cleaning hard floors, your Steam Mop should only be used on tiles, linoleum, sealed hardwood flooring, engineered hardwood, laminate, vinyl and sealed stone floors. If used on waxed flooring, you may experience loss of glossiness. To reduce the risk of personal injury, unplug the steam cleaner when assembling the accessories. Do not clean over floor electrical outlets. Do not use steam cleaner or press the Steam Trigger without water in the water tank.

TO SANITIZE HARD SURFACES

Turn the solution dial to "OFF" position and steam control dial to "MAX" position. Connect the microfiber pad and run a minimum of 6 strokes at a medium pace (5-7 seconds per 32" stroke) across same area. Allow to dry

Replacing the hard water filter

WARNING To reduce the risk of personal injury - Unplug Steam Mop before servicing and allow to cool.

• IMPORTANT • The condition of the filter affects the performance of your machine. Check and change filter (depending on level of use and water conditions in your area). Do not operate Steam Mop without Water Filter in place.

1 Remove the water tank to access the hard water filter.

2 Pull to remove the hard water filter.

3 New filter has a (beige/cream color).

4 Hard water filter should be replaced every 6-8 months or when discolored.

Clearing blockages

WARNING To reduce the risk of personal injury - Unplug Steam Mop before servicing and allow to cool.

1 If there is an obstruction to the steam flow through the machine, steam may release through the bleed valve.

2 To remove the floor head from the body push the floor head release button and lift.

3 After the floor head is removed, use a thin object such as a paperclip (in the area shown), to remove the blockage.

4 With the pad removed from the floor head, insert a small thin object such as a paper-clip in to the steam holes to remove a blockage.

Storage

• Unplug the power cord.

• Allow time to cool.

• Empty the residual fluid from the twin tank and clean the external surface with a dry cloth. Allow to dry.

• Re-install twin tank.

• You may leave solution in solution tank for short period of time, but if you are going to leave solution in tank for more than 2 weeks, it is recommended to empty the solution tank.
